Output c781177512f5d8d8ef60667bb5755dfe7d88c4b6ba63ea1f35c68bad4823ebd2:29

value
1240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f617a389b24350108855823f8c5a61452492bc6 OP_EQUAL
address
MSogszLahHyoL8U7B7nNkYhAt33grQXQiQ
transaction
c781177512f5d8d8ef60667bb5755dfe7d88c4b6ba63ea1f35c68bad4823ebd2
spent
true